Capacity note for the Fennelgrid sidecar review. Aggregation window widened to cut emit rate; per-pod memory ceiling holds at current cardinality (~12k series). CPU flat. Risk: buffer overflow if a tenant spikes labels — mitigated by the drop policy. No node-pool changes needed for the Caldermoor cluster this quarter. Review the flush and buffer settings before merge. Constants under review are below.

limits module of yafop-hahag:
QUOTAS = {
    "tamwyn": 652,
    "prawyn": 731,
}

Action item (P1, owner: Darnell): the Quillcast notification fan-out lacked backpressure when the push gateway slowed, so queued deliveries ballooned until workers OOMed. We will add a bounded queue with shed-oldest semantics, plus a consumer-lag gauge wired into paging thresholds. Darnell will prototype the bounded queue this sprint and bring latency numbers to the sync; we also need agreement on acceptable drop rates for low-priority digests. Background, graphs from the incident, and the proposed config are on the internal page.

operations page: https://vault.qirvanhq.local/ticket

Subject: Static-analysis baseline refreshed — action for on-call

Team, the Lintgrove baseline file for the Copperquay repo was regenerated after the parser upgrade, so roughly forty previously suppressed findings now appear as resolved rather than new. If tonight's scan flags unexpected diffs, compare against the refreshed baseline before paging anyone; stale caches on the runners were the cause last time. Full steps are in the runbook. The baseline was produced under the token below.

trace token, fafog-kageg: htk4_98e6

## Read-Replica Lag Alarm

New folks: the ReplicaLagHigh alarm covers the Ostrel reporting replicas. It fires when lag exceeds 90 seconds for five minutes. Most triggers come from the nightly Bramwell export job, which is expected and auto-resolves. Do not fail over the replica yourself — that requires the data-platform lead's approval and a change ticket. If the alarm persists past 20 minutes with no export running, write to the platform inbox.

billing contact of yahip-yadup = eliax.druix@zemvarworks.corp